Join Stockland's dynamic Cyber Security team and play a pivotal role in shaping our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) program. We're looking for a highly skilled and motivated professional to support and enhance our cyber security frameworks, ensuring alignment with business requirements and regulatory standards.

The Opportunity - About the Role

This role supports the delivery of Stockland's Cyber Security Governance, Risk, and Compliance program. You'll work across teams to manage cyber risk, coordinate assurance activities, and help implement security frameworks—while leveraging AI tools to improve outcomes and efficiency.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support and maintain Stockland's Cyber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) program, including third-party security assessments and risk register management.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and third-party providers to coordinate cyber assurance activities, audits, and remediation tracking.
  • Maintain and report on key cyber and technology risk metrics, ensuring alignment with business requirements and regulatory standards.
  • Contribute to the development and implementation of security frameworks, policies, and enterprise threat models.
  • Ethically leverage Artificial Intelligence (AI) tools to enhance decision-making, operational efficiency, and cyber risk management.

About You

You're a proactive and experienced cyber security professional with a strong understanding of governance, risk, and compliance. You thrive in collaborative environments and are passionate about using technology and innovation to drive secure, efficient outcomes. You bring:

  • Degree-qualified with extensive experience in cyber security, technology governance, or IT operations.
  • Certified or knowledgeable in ISO 27000, SANS GIAC, CISA, or CISM frameworks.
  • Proven ability to deliver cyber services and manage risk-based security programs.
  • Strong communication, stakeholder engagement, and project coordination skills.
  • Skilled in leveraging AI tools ethically to enhance decision-making and operational efficiency.
